I did some calculation and for Davis to drop out of top 16, you need at least 4 of the 5 things happen and they can all happen at the same time:
1. Day pass first round
2. Hawkins pass first round
3. Swail or Parry get to quarters
4. Bottom Half: Matthew Stevens or Selby or Carter get to their semi or Mark Allen wins the world
5. Top Half: Michael Holt get to Semi or Hamilton or McCulloch to win the world
Note: I've figured if Matthew Stevens do get to semi, his score will tie with Davis at 24950, how is that gonna work out?
